Section 32:
Power to remove difficulties.
(1) If any difficulty arises in giving effect to the provisions of
this Act, the Central Government may, by order published in the Official Gazette, make such provisions,
not inconsistent with the provisions of this Act, as appear to it to be necessary or expedient for removing
the difficulty:
Provided that no such order shall be made under this section after the expiry of the period of three
years from the commencement of this Act.
(2) Every order made under sub-section (1) shall be laid, as soon as may be after it is made, before
each House of Parliament.
